Within Chapter 10 – Cereals, HSN Code 10071000 serves as the official classification for Seed. This code determines tax rates and compliance obligations for all entities trading in Seed. CGST applies at 2.5%/Nil, SGST/UTGST at 2.5%/Nil for local transactions, and IGST at 5%/Nil for interstate supplies. Measurement is standardized in kg..

GST Rates for HSN 10071000
The taxation of Seed under HSN Code 10071000 depends on supply location. Intrastate transactions require CGST at 2.5%/Nil and SGST/UTGST at 2.5%/Nil. Interstate supplies are charged IGST at 5%/Nil. Invoices should consistently use kg. for Cereals goods under Chapter 10.

The number of HSN digits depends on your annual turnover. Businesses with turnover above Rs 5 crore must mention 6 digits, while others may use 4 digits. Always use the complete HSN 10071000 for accurate classification of Seed.
Yes, registered businesses can claim input tax credit on Seed purchases made under HSN 10071000. Ensure your supplier mentions correct HSN code and GST rates (2.5%/Nil, 2.5%/Nil) on the invoice.
CGST at 2.5%/Nil plus SGST/UTGST at 2.5%/Nil applies when Seed is sold within the same state. IGST at 5%/Nil is charged when goods move across state borders or are imported.
